Q: Is 1,366,324 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 1,366,324 is not a prime number.

Why is 1,366,324 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 1366324 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 17 34 68 71 142 283 284 566 1,132 1,207 2,414 4,811 4,828 9,622 19,244 20,093 40,186 80,372 341,581 683,162 and 1,366,324, with no remainder.

Since 1,366,324 cannot be divided by just 1 and 1,366,324, it is not a prime number.
